Which Doctor to Consult for Hernia Repair?

For hernia repair surgery, you should consult general surgeons who have specialization in performing laparoscopic surgeries i.e., minimally-invasive surgeries. These doctors are qualified and highly trained in performing laparoscopic surgeries with maximum success rate. If you are looking for a laparoscopic surgeon to get your hernia repaired, put your thoughts and take time to do research.

Do your research about the surgeon’s background, and compare educational qualifications, skills and certifications with the other surgeons to make an informed decision for the surgery. Having a complete understanding of your condition, treatment options, and your surgeon’s abilities is imperative before undergoing surgery.

To make it easy for you, we have provided a list of factors that you should consider before finalizing your laparoscopic surgeon for hernia repair treatment.

  1. What are the Doctor’s Certifications?

Before finalizing the surgeon for the procedure, make sure that the surgeon is fully certified. Listed below are a few certificates that a laparoscopic surgeon must possess before proceeding with hernia repair surgery.

  • Bachelor of Medicine and Bachelor of Surgery (MBBS)
  • MS in General Surgery
  • Specialization in Laparoscopic Surgeries
  • Certified by a specific board
  1. What are the Skills and Experience of the Surgeon?

It is one of the most important factors to consider when selecting a surgeon for surgery. You should thoroughly research the skills and experience of the surgeon. Before the procedure, make sure to ask all the questions you have in your mind about the treatment, the doctor’s experience, and the qualifications to get assured that you are in safe hands.

Also, do your research and check the track record of success in this type of surgery. By doing so, you can be confident enough that you are going to get the best quality treatment from a skilled surgeon.

  1. What are the Reviews of Former Patients about the Surgeon?

Trusting your surgeon is crucial as a patient, and knowing the surgeon’s credibility will give you peace of mind. For this, you can check the online reviews of the former patients of the surgeon who have had the same treatment by the surgeon you are going to choose. You can directly ask your family or friends to give you a reference if they have any good laparoscopic surgeons in their known.

  1. Does the Hospital Where the Surgeon Works Rank Well in Terms of Quality?

It is a good idea to check the hospital’s rating in terms of quality, with which the surgeon is affiliated, before seeking medical treatment. It gives you an assurance that the surgeon is well-qualified and associated with one of the best hospitals. Hospitals that have been awarded or accredited are likely to have doctors with the same reputation. There is a general rule that a good hospital has a good medical staff.

  1. Ask Questions

As a last step before finalizing a doctor, make sure you have gathered all the information about the doctor and the treatment.

Here are some important questions you can ask the laparoscopic surgeon to win the trust and proceed with the treatment.

  • Have you specialized in laparoscopic surgeries?
  • What experience do you have performing laparoscopic surgeries?
  • What does your hernia repair procedure typically involve?
  • What happens during the recovery period?
  • Are there any potential risks or complications?
  • How long does the procedure last?
  • What type of anesthesia will be used?
  • What kind of follow-up care is necessary after hernia repair surgery?
  • Do you have experience dealing with any complications that may arise during the procedure?
  • Are there any possible side effects of hernia repair surgery?

By asking the right questions before the surgery, you can have peace of mind and trust in your surgeon.

Take the Right Approach to Consult Doctor for Hernia Repair

Before booking an appointment with the laparoscopic surgeon, take the correct approach ease your treatment journey.

The first and most important step when consulting a doctor for hernia repair surgery is to do your research. Read up on the procedure, the risks and benefits, and any other relevant information you can find. It’s also important to understand the different types of hernia repair surgery; some types, such as laparoscopic and open surgery, come with different risks and benefits.

When consulting a doctor, be sure to have a list of questions ready to ask. Asking questions can help you get a better understanding of the procedure and the risks, as well as the doctor’s experience and qualifications. Make sure to discuss the potential risks and benefits in detail, as well as the cost and any other questions you may have.

Be sure to ask your doctor about any lifestyle changes you may need to make before or after the surgery. Depending on the type of surgery, you may need to make changes to your diet, activity level, and other lifestyle factors.

Finally, make sure you understand the recovery process. Ask your doctor about any follow-up visits you may need, and make sure you have a good pain management plan in place to help you through the recovery process.

Overall, it’s important to take the time to consult with a doctor and ask the right questions when considering hernia repair surgery. Doing your research and asking the right questions will help ensure you have the best possible outcome from the procedure.

When to Visit a Laparoscopic Surgeon for Hernia Repair

In some cases, hernias are small and asymptomatic. In such cases, visiting a laparoscopic surgeon is not required. Small hernias does not cause intense swelling, bulges or extreme pain, then you don’t need surgery on immidiate basis. But, it is important to realize when the hernias are large and causing symptoms, can lead to more severe complications if left untreated.

Some of the common symptoms mentioned below. If you experience these symptoms, you must consult a laparoscopic surgeon for the hernia repair surgery or herniorrhaphy.

  • Nausea and vomiting
  • Intense swelling
  • Extreme pain surrounding bulge
  • Fever
  • Strangulation in intestine
  • Feeling of fullness

If hernia is left untreated, it can lead to more serious complications. So, it is better to consult a laparoscopic surgeon at initial stage of hernia development to avoid the complications.

If you’re experiencing any of these symptoms, it’s important to schedule an appointment with a laparoscopic surgeon as soon as possible.
